Peta Hiku and Ryan Hall starred in Hull KR’s home victory against Huddersfield on Friday. Both players scored braces, and Ryan Hall went on to finally equal and break the all-time Super League try-scoring record!

Liam Marshall continues as Super League’s current top try-scorer and added to his tally on Friday with two tries to seal a Wigan win against Castleford.

Three Salford players appear in this week’s Team of the Week. Nene Macdonald is having a quality season and continued his monstrous metre-making in Round 14 with 181 metres in just 18 carries, as well as scoring a try.

Marc Sneyd also features. It was another perfect and Player of the Match performance for the number 7 on Friday, with one try, the match-winning try assist, and match-winning drop goal against Warrington.

Sam Stone also came up with a sensational defensive effort – racking up a total of 52 tackles.

It’s a trio of Hull FC players for the first time this season, as the Black & Whites produced a gutsy performance to beat Leeds Rhinos on home soil.

Jake Trueman was the brains of the operation, while Herman Ese’ese had a stunning performance all-round – 27 tackles, 8 tackle busts, and 139 metres in 17 carries. Cameron Scott came up with the host’s third and final try, which gave them an 18-0 advantage.

Leigh's Tom Amone scored the only try of the game in Catalans v Leigh on Saturday evening, and Matt Moylan was also integral to the Leopards’ second win over the Dragons this season.

On Sunday, St Helens outclassed London Broncos with a 6-52 victory in the capital. It was a seven-minute hat-trick for hooker Daryl Clark in the second half, while team-mate James Bell was constantly at the heart of the Saints action – with two try assists and seven tackle busts.
